Our Philosophy
We teach Romanian as a living language. That means:
-
Conversation first, grammar in context.
-
Meaning before memorization.
-
Motivation as the key to mastery.
Because when you care about the language, you learn faster, remember more, and connect deeper. That's the heart of the Fusion Method.

Dr. Simona Sigartău
M.A. in Romanian Language
Simona Sigartău holds a BA in Romanian Language and Literature from the Babeș-Bolyai University. She holds an MA degree in Romanian Literary Studies from the same University and since 2021, she holds a PhD degree in Philology. She succeeds to communicate efficiently with her students and she listens emphatically to their needs; she is a very good observer who helps students feel comfortable and be attentive at the same time.
Ioana Dinu
M.A. in Romanian Language
Ioana-Adela Dinu holds a BA in Romanian Language and Literature from “Lucian Blaga” University of Sibiu and has been teaching Romanian since 2001. She is a communicative, enthusiastic, and patient teacher, making learning Romanian easy for beginners, intermediate, and advanced students. Using effective teaching methods, she helps learners gain confidence and fluency in Romanian.
